Top 5 Scores In A Test Innings By A Captain

A team is as good as its captain. Behind the success story of a team is a tale of the captaining leading from the front frequently. Even the best of batsmen in the modern day cricket which have been summed up the ‘Fab 4’ are also amazing captains besides being stalwart cricketers.

These Fab Four include Steve Smith, Virat Kohli, Kane Williamson and Joe Root. All of these great captains have changed the fortunes of their teams and have always led from the front.

So here we take a look at the best knocks in a test innings by a captain. These knocks are the best endorsement of ‘Leading from the front’ and these are the greatest knocks by captains in a test inning.

On top of the list is Brian Lara’s marathon knock of an unbeaten 400. This is the highest score by any batsman in a test innings. Surprisingly there’s no Indian in the top 5 but we would trust Virat Kohli to make it to the top 5 pretty soon.

Here’s the list of 5 highest test scores in an innings by a captain
1. Brian Lara: 400*

This is the highest ever individual score in test cricket and is an unbelievable one. It came against England in the year 2004 at St. John’s. Brian Lara is the only cricketer ever to score 400 runs in a test innings.
2. Mahela Jayawardene: 374

The former Sri Lankan skipper scored 374 runs against South Africa in Colombo. He achieved this feat in the year 2006.
3. Mark Taylor: 334*

The former Aussie Skipper is a big contributing factor to Australia’s domination in world cricket. Mark Taylor played a staggering knock of 334 at Peshawar against Pakistan in 1998.
4. Graham Gooch: 333

He’s on of the legends to have ever played the game. The former captain of England scored this triple century against India at Lords. It came in the year 1990.
5. Michael Clarke: 329*

Clarke struck this magnificent triple century as a captain against India at Sydney. Clark gave this great example of leading from the front in the year 2012.
